Job Description

At Mastercard, we believe in driving innovation and empowering our clients to achieve their strategic goals. As an Associate Managing Consultant for our Strategy & Transformation team, you will have the opportunity to work with top industry leaders and utilize cutting-edge technology to help shape the future of the payments industry. We are looking for a dynamic and results-driven individual who is passionate about driving transformation and delivering impactful solutions for our clients. If you have a strong background in strategy consulting, exceptional problem-solving skills, and a track record of driving business growth, we want you to join our team and be a part of our mission to make the world a more connected and inclusive place.

  1. Conduct in-depth research and analysis to identify industry trends, market opportunities, and client needs.
  2. Collaborate with senior consultants to develop and implement strategic initiatives for clients.
  3. Utilize advanced data analysis and modeling techniques to generate insights and support decision-making.
  4. Lead client workshops and presentations to communicate findings and recommendations.
  5. Develop and maintain strong relationships with clients, serving as a trusted advisor and key point of contact.
  6. Proactively identify areas for improvement and provide recommendations for optimizing business processes and operations.
  7. Use project management skills to oversee the successful delivery of projects within budget and timeline constraints.
  8. Stay up-to-date with industry developments, emerging technologies, and best practices in strategy consulting.
  9. Mentor and guide junior consultants, providing them with the necessary support and resources for their professional growth.
  10. Continuously strive to exceed client expectations and drive business growth through innovative and impactful solutions.
  11.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including sales, marketing, and technology, to develop and implement integrated strategies.
  12. Communicate effectively with internal and external stakeholders to ensure alignment and successful project outcomes.
  13. Adhere to company policies and procedures, maintaining the highest standards of ethics and professionalism.
  14. Represent Mastercard and the Strategy & Transformation team at industry events and conferences.
  15. Contribute to the development and enhancement of consulting methodologies and tools.

About Mastercard

Mastercard is a leader in global payments and a technology company that connects billions of consumers, thousand of financial institutions, and millions of merchants, as well as governments and businesses around the world.
